Files
claudetools/projects/dataforth-dos/batch-files/CTONW.BAT
OC-5070 77c23635df Fix CTONWTXT path case: Stage -> STAGE for DOS 6.22 compatibility
Mixed-case paths caused "invalid directory" on TS-27. All paths now uppercase
to match DOS convention and Samba default case = upper setting.

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-03-28 15:03:33 -07:00

48 lines
1.5 KiB
Batchfile

@ECHO OFF
REM Computer to Network - Upload local test results to network
REM Version: 5.0 - Added user-facing ECHO for each step
REM Last modified: 2026-03-28
REM Verify MACHINE variable is set
IF "%MACHINE%"=="" GOTO NO_MACHINE
ECHO ........................................
ECHO CTONW v5.0 - Uploading %MACHINE% data to network
ECHO ........................................
ECHO CTONW.BAT v5.0 > C:\ATE\CTONW.LOG
ECHO Machine: %MACHINE% >> C:\ATE\CTONW.LOG
ECHO (1/5) Test logs -> T:\%MACHINE%\LOGS
COPY C:\ATE\5BLOG\*.DAT T:\%MACHINE%\LOGS\5BLOG
COPY C:\ATE\7BLOG\*.DAT T:\%MACHINE%\LOGS\7BLOG
COPY C:\ATE\7BLOG\*.SHT T:\%MACHINE%\LOGS\7BLOG
COPY C:\ATE\8BLOG\*.DAT T:\%MACHINE%\LOGS\8BLOG
COPY C:\ATE\DSCLOG\*.DAT T:\%MACHINE%\LOGS\DSCLOG
COPY C:\ATE\HVLOG\*.DAT T:\%MACHINE%\LOGS\HVLOG
COPY C:\ATE\PWRLOG\*.DAT T:\%MACHINE%\LOGS\PWRLOG
COPY C:\ATE\SCTLOG\*.DAT T:\%MACHINE%\LOGS\SCTLOG
COPY C:\ATE\VASLOG\*.DAT T:\%MACHINE%\LOGS\VASLOG
ECHO (2/5) Reports -> T:\%MACHINE%\Reports
COPY C:\Reports\*.TXT T:\%MACHINE%\Reports
ECHO (3/5) Text datasheets -> T:\STAGE\%MACHINE%
CALL C:\BAT\CTONWTXT.BAT
ECHO (4/5) Log files -> T:\%MACHINE%
COPY C:\ATE\*.LOG T:\%MACHINE%
ECHO (5/5) Upload complete
ECHO ........................................
GOTO END
:NO_MACHINE
ECHO ........................................
ECHO ERROR: MACHINE variable not set
ECHO Run DEPLOY.BAT or ATESYNC first
ECHO ........................................
PAUSE
GOTO END
:END